REID EAGER TO GET GOING

5 June 2019

Tyler Reid says he is ready to take the chance given to him by Swindon manager, Richie Wellens, after joining the club on Monday.

Reid became Town’s first summer signing after being released by Swansea at the end of the 2018/19 season and this will be the second time he has worked with his new boss.

While Reid was making his way through the United academy, Wellens was working with Paul McGuinness who coached the young full-back during his time with Red Devils.

Wellens described his new acquisition as ‘one who stood out’ alongside England international, Marcus Rashford.

Speaking to iFollow Swindon, the right-back spoke about his new club and his new Gaffer.

“The place looks good and I’m ready for it to be my home really. The Gaffer says he wants to give me a chance and I’m ready to take it.

“He’s obviously Mancunian which is where I’ve been living for around seven years so we can click in that way but he seems like a good guy and I’m happy to be working with him.”

Reid has an instant physical presence – big and muscular – and looks forward to impressing the Swindon faithful from right-back.

“I offer a lot of pace and power – I like to get forward a lot but I like to think I’m sturdy in defence as well so that’s what they can expect from me.”
